Effective Stress Management Techniques
There are several practical techniques for managing stress that can help restore balance in your life. Here are a few:
- Mindfulness and Meditation: Practicing mindfulness through meditation can significantly reduce stress levels by promoting relaxation and enhancing the connection between the mind and body.
- Regular Exercise: Engaging in physical activities, such as cardio workouts or strength training, can release endorphins—natural stress relievers that boost your mood.
- Quality Sleep: Prioritizing good sleep hygiene can help rejuvenate your mind and body, making you more resilient to stressors.

The Role of Nutrition in Stress Management
What you eat can significantly influence your stress levels. A bal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ains can support your body’s ability to cope with stress.
